新聞中心
在HTML中,可以使用CSS的display: flex屬性讓三個(gè)div平行排列。具體代碼如下:,,``html,,,,, .container {, display: flex;, }, .box {, width: 100px;, height: 100px;, border: 1px solid black;, },,,,,, , , ,,,,,``
在HTML中,我們可以使用CSS的布局屬性來讓三個(gè)div平行,以下是詳細(xì)的步驟:

成都創(chuàng)新互聯(lián)公司主營成縣網(wǎng)站建設(shè)的網(wǎng)絡(luò)公司,主營網(wǎng)站建設(shè)方案,App定制開發(fā),成縣h5成都小程序開發(fā)搭建,成縣網(wǎng)站營銷推廣歡迎成縣等地區(qū)企業(yè)咨詢
1、我們需要?jiǎng)?chuàng)建一個(gè)包含三個(gè)div的父div,每個(gè)子div都將被放置在這個(gè)父div中。
2、我們需要為父div設(shè)置一個(gè)相對(duì)定位(position: relative;),這樣我們就可以相對(duì)于父div來定位子div。
3、接下來,我們需要為每個(gè)子div設(shè)置一個(gè)絕對(duì)定位(position: absolute;),這樣,每個(gè)子div就會(huì)相對(duì)于其父div進(jìn)行定位。
4、我們需要為每個(gè)子div設(shè)置一個(gè)寬度(width)和高度(height),這樣,每個(gè)子div就會(huì)有一個(gè)固定的大小。
以下是相應(yīng)的CSS代碼:
.parent {
position: relative;
}
.child {
position: absolute;
width: 100px;
height: 100px;
}
.child:nth-child(1) {
top: 0;
}
.child:nth-child(2) {
top: 50%;
}
.child:nth-child(3) {
top: 100%;
}
在這個(gè)例子中,我們使用了:nth-child()偽類選擇器來選擇每個(gè)子div,并分別設(shè)置了它們的頂部位置(top),這樣,三個(gè)子div就會(huì)在父div中平行排列。
相關(guān)問題與解答:
問題1:如何讓三個(gè)div垂直排列?
答案:要讓三個(gè)div垂直排列,只需要將上述CSS代碼中的top屬性改為left或right即可,將.child:nth-child(2)的top改為left,將.child:nth-child(3)的top改為right。
問題2:如何讓三個(gè)div按照一定的順序排列?
答案:要讓三個(gè)div按照一定的順序排列,可以使用flexbox或者grid布局,使用flexbox,可以為父div設(shè)置display: flex;,然后為每個(gè)子div設(shè)置order屬性來調(diào)整它們的順序。
網(wǎng)頁題目:html中如何讓三個(gè)div平行
網(wǎng)頁路徑:http://m.fisionsoft.com.cn/article/cciojjj.html


咨詢
建站咨詢
